I was looking through some pics of the fastcats track, i saw the best frequency board ever. correct me if i am wrong, but what they are doing is taking pictures of the drivers with a poliroid camera, then the driver posts the picture of them on the frequency they are on. then others know who is using the frequency.

GREAT IDEA GUYS!!!!
